Best Upper Rockridge 51³Ô¹ÏÍøºÚÁÏ (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,715 students in the neighborhood of Upper Rockridge, Oakland, CA.
The top ranked public schools in Upper Rockridge are Hillcrest, Chabot Elementary School and Aspire Langston Hughes Academy.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Upper Rockridge, Oakland, CA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 27% (versus the California public school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 62% (versus the 47%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 74%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the California public school average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
